Transaction ce51049385031018d4fe9c1f58f6f3c7ecd577e920d7a19ea54b27de9da53c85
1 Input
1 Output
-
ce51049385031018d4fe9c1f58f6f3c7ecd577e920d7a19ea54b27de9da53c85:0
- value
- 198630
- script pubkey
- OP_0 OP_PUSHBYTES_20 68ed42f50ecd0eaa76c4d4d243ca36ff6356e62b
- address
- bc1qdrk59agwe5825aky6nfy8j3kla34de3t023q7a